“assurance d’art et d’objets de collection” is a type of insurance specifically designed to protect art and collectible items. Whether you are a seasoned collector or just starting out, having the right insurance coverage is essential in safeguarding your investments. This type of insurance typically covers a wide range of items, including but not limited to paintings, sculptures, antique furniture, jewelry, vintage cars, and rare books.
One of the key benefits of “assurance d’art et d’objets de collection” is that it provides coverage for a variety of risks. This can include damage caused by fire, water, theft, vandalism, or accidental breakage. In the unfortunate event that one of your pieces is damaged or stolen, having insurance can help offset the financial burden of repairing or replacing the item. Additionally, some policies may also cover the cost of restoration, appraisal fees, and even loss of value due to damage.
Another important aspect of “assurance d’art et d’objets de collection” is that it can offer protection for items that are in transit. Whether you are transporting your art collection to a new location or loaning out pieces for an exhibition, having insurance coverage can provide peace of mind knowing that your valuables are protected every step of the way. This can be especially important for collectors who frequently buy, sell, or loan out their pieces.

When obtaining “assurance d’art et d’objets de collection,” it is important to accurately document and appraise your items. This can include keeping detailed records of each piece, including photographs, descriptions, provenance, and current market value. Having this information readily available can streamline the claims process and ensure that you receive fair compensation in the event of a loss.
It is also worth noting that the cost of “assurance d’art et d’objets de collection” can vary depending on several factors, including the total value of your collection, the types of items being insured, your location, and the level of coverage you require. Some insurance providers may offer discounts for security measures such as alarm systems, safes, and climate-controlled storage facilities.
